Forbes, Other Events Fill Hong Kong's Calendar

Forbes will hold a series of major business events in Hong Kong in late 2003 and early 2004. The three main events in the pipeline are the “Best Under a Billion" Forbes Global 200 Best Small Companies, Forbes US 2003 CEO Forum and Forbes Global CEO Conference. All these signify the organizers? complete confidence in Hong Kong following the SARS outbreak.

A series of activities will be launched in the coming months to boost Hong Kong's business and tourism.“Best Under a Billion" is scheduled for November and will attract over 100 CEO or senior business representatives from all over the world, while the Hong Kong Special Administrative Region Government is sponsoring the CEO Forum, which will be held in Richmond, Virginia this autumn. The CEO Conference will be held in Hong Kong in the spring of 2004.

As well, Hong Kong will co-operate with Forbes to organize a series of business receptions and activities. 

These business occasions combine with the mega sports and entertainment activities designed to restore Hong Kong’s reputation and revive the economy following the SARS outbreak. 

For instance, Liverpool will participate in an exhibition soccer match in Hong Kong this summer, while the Chinese National Basketball Team, including star Yao Ming, will play in Hong Kong sometime this year.

The roster of entertainment and cultural events for the year includes the June Seafood Festival in Sai Kung, a Gifts & Premium Fair in July, a Strato-Fantasia laser and musical show in August and the East meets West Soho carnival in September.
